Key Components of a Corporate Wellness Program
1. Physical Health and Fitness Initiatives
Investing in corporate fitness programs encourages employees to stay active, reducing health risks such as obesity, heart disease, and stress-related illnesses. Some companies offer on-site gyms, subsidized gym memberships, or group fitness classes like corporate yoga.
2. Mental Health Support
Employee well-being extends beyond physical fitness. Implementing corporate mental health programs helps employees manage stress and improve emotional resilience. Providing access to mental health screenings, mindfulness workshops, and wellness coaching can significantly impact workplace morale.
3. Health Screenings and Preventative Care
Regular employee health screenings can identify early signs of illness, helping employees take preventive measures before minor health concerns become serious. Encouraging corporate nutrition plans and healthy meal options in the office also supports a proactive approach to well-being.
4. Workplace Flexibility and Stress Management
Flexible work arrangements and stress-reducing initiatives, such as wellness coaching, workplace mindfulness programs, and ergonomic office designs, create an environment where employees feel supported and valued. Companies with structured wellness programs often report lower absenteeism and higher job satisfaction.
The Business Benefits of Corporate Wellness Programs
1. Increased Employee Productivity
Healthy employees are more energetic, focused, and engaged in their work. Studies show that businesses with corporate wellness programs experience higher productivity and lower absenteeism.
2. Reduced Healthcare Costs
By prioritizing preventive health measures, fitness programs, and mental wellness initiatives, companies can lower healthcare expenses. Employees who exercise regularly and engage in wellness activities have fewer doctor visits and take fewer sick days.
3. Improved Employee Retention and Satisfaction
Employees value workplaces that invest in their well-being. Companies offering wellness coaching, corporate fitness programs, and stress management initiatives tend to have higher retention rates and a more positive company culture.
4. Stronger Team Engagement
Group wellness activities, like corporate exercise programs and wellness challenges, encourage teamwork and collaboration. This leads to stronger workplace relationships and a more connected workforce.
